TICKET-4417: Signature verification failed on the extracted user-module artifact from the Pelagia monolith split. Cause: the carve-out pipeline signs with the legacy monolith key while verify expects the new module key. Do not re-sign manually. Update the verifier config to trust the module key below.

signing key of yajog-kafof = bky19_orbYRY3Abj3KpZesMie

Quillframe publishes components under semantic versioning, with major bumps gated by the Hollowbrook review board. Security reviewers should note that signed release manifests are generated per version and stored in the Lanternvale artifact registry. Unsigned builds never reach production consumers. Deprecated versions stay installable for 90 days, then are tombstoned. To audit the signing chain, you will need read access to the ceremony vault, which is unlocked with the recovery passphrase below.

vault phrase of yawig-bawig = fenael-norael-eliox-gilox-casath-druath-zorys-istwyn-jorwyn

Quarterly Planning Note — Calder & Finch Holdings

The franchise agreement with Roamstead Cafés enters renewal negotiation this quarter. Royalty terms, territory exclusivity for the Ellowen region, and brand-standard audits are the open items. Counsel expects drafting to conclude within six weeks. The board should review the confidential terms summary below.

confidential, hahop-bajep: Gross margin on Ralath came in at 5 percent against a plan of 10 percent. Only 9 of the 100 pilot accounts renewed Ralath, so a churn review is set for April 1.

Subject: Brightway line pricing — heads up

Hi branch managers, quick note before the all-hands. We're adjusting Brightway pricing next quarter: a modest uplift on the core units and a bundled discount for the Harrowell accessories. Please don't quote new rates until the official sheet lands — a few branches jumped early last time and it got messy. Questions to Priya or me. The confidential reasoning behind this move is set out below.

confidential, bahip-hadug: Headcount on the Norir team goes from 29 to 116 by the end of August. Gross margin on Norir came in at 6 percent against a plan of 59 percent.